Tift County Sheriff's Office, Georgia
End of Watch Saturday, June 8, 1991
Add to My HeroesRaymond Bussell Merritt
Captain Raymond Merritt was shot and killed while answering a domestic disturbance call on Bill Bowen Road in Tifton.
When Captain Merritt arrived at the home, he and other officers attempted to talk to a man who had barricaded himself in a separate building on the property after striking his wife and daughter. As the officers and deputies stepped onto the porch of the house, the man fired, striking Captain Merritt. Other officers and deputies returned fire, wounding the subject.
The suspect pleaded guilty but mentally ill to the murder and was sentenced to life in prison. He died in 2013.
Captain Merritt was a United States Army veteran who had served with the Tift County Sheriff's Office for 19 years and previously served with the Tifton Police Department. He was survived by his wife and two children.
